Claire Beck

d. March 3, 2006

Claire Simpson Beck returned to the arms of her Heavenly Father Friday March 03, 2006. She slipped peacefully away at home, surrounded by her family. Claire was born September 24, 1917 in Kemmerer Wyoming to Edith Herring and Oscar James Simpson, the youngest of 5 children. Upon high school graduation she moved to Salt Lake City to pursue her dream of becoming a nurse and graduated as a Registered Nurse from the University of Utah/St. Marks Hospital School of Nursing. In Salt Lake she met and married Edward Smoot Beck, the marriage was later solemnized in the Salt Lake Temple. They had four children. She worked at the old St. Mark?s Hospital until the family moved to Bountiful and then worked at Bountiful Medical Center until retirement. After retirement Claire and Edward began to travel the West, spending winters in St. George and summers in Bountiful. When Edward became ill, they sold the St. George property and returned to Bountiful to be with family. Claire was an avid rose grower and golfer, but her greatest talent was to make and be a wonderful friend. Claire was preceded in death by her parents, siblings, her husband Edward, and two grandchildren. She is survived by her children: Barbara Wolfe Jerry, Robert Beck Laura, Susan Trump Roland, and Christine Perry Andy, one niece Carolyn Gunter, Wyoming, one nephew Robert Stadmiller, California, 18 Grandchildren, and 15 Great Grandchildren.
